The trigger construction of the majority of optical switches is the same as that of mechanical switches, including a spring and a comparable housing structure. The optical switches have various architectures to provide various typing feedback, such as linear, tactile, and clicky, much as different mechanical switches give distinct typing experiences.
Nonetheless, the trigger mechanism is the primary distinction between optical and mechanical switches. Whereas optical switches are activated by an optical sensor that detects the induction of a light signal to record a key, mechanical switches are activated by the metal leaf connection and disconnection.

The lifespan of optical switches is longer.
When mechanical switches malfunction, it's usually because of issues with the flake trigger or the footpin. Since optical switches are activated by light signals, they are not affected by these issues. Consequently, optical switches have a lifespan of more than 100 million clicks and are more resilient. Typically, mechanical switches can withstand 50 million clicks.
Replacing optical switches is simpler.
Replacing an optical switch is simple if it is the same model. Keyboards with mechanical switches that aren't hot-swappable require soldering to replace the switch. The optical switches are more practical in terms of simplicity of modification.
